Hype Machine is your friend. Imo, about 90% of the music on there is usually electro.
Just browse through the different songs until you start to find some blogs you consistently like music from (gottadancedirty ^^^ is one of my favorites) and then click the heart and follow it. Once you get a nice amount of blogs favorited you can just go to the "watchlist songs" most of the time and you'll find loads of good music.
Just a suggestion. That's primarily how I find new music.
